For riverside cities, their waterfront public space becomes one of the main public domains. This cultural heritage constitutes the city's identity. Based on the richness of its heritage, are cities developing an adequate functional offer aimed at the modern user? The article presents the results of a study of the functional quality of the public space of the Vistula River Boulevards in Kraków. The level of functional complexity of the Boulevards was determined by defining the types of its fragments in spatial-functional and historical terms, and then subjecting them to the author's multi-criteria valorization. The results of the valorization of the functional resources of the riverside public space made it possible to formulate conclusions for determining the potentials and threats of the studied riverside public space.
